> > [PATCH] [TCP]: Fix invalid skb referencing in LOST marker code
> > 
> > The after() referenced an invalid skb if loop exited when skb had
> > reached sk_write_queue. I chose to move this part inside the loop
> > where the skb is valid (so no need to check for that like I first
> > suggested), which also allows dropping of couple of conditions
> > from the if.
> > 
> > Signed-off-by: Ilpo Järvinen <ilpo.jarvinen@helsinki.fi>
> 
> Patch applied, thanks a lot Ilpo.

I can no longer trigger the bug, thanks Ilpo.
